Waris Larmandier
Avize, Champagne Maison Waris Larmandier was founded in 1989, but the estate's vineyards have been producing for a long time before that. In 2000, Marie Helen Larmandier took over the reins (following the death of her husband Vincent Waris) and catapulted the Maison and its 9 hectares into biodynamic conversion with the help of her three children, Jean Philippe, Pierre Louis and Ines. Demeter certified. The sixth generation of vigneron in the family. This Maison is a true living being in which animals, such as the horses that plough the soil, the chickens that eliminate parasites and the sheep that graze the grass, participate fully in production. Waris Larmandier's main objective is to produce exceptional Champagnes that identify with the territory and history of Avize and are perceived as true and sincere by their customers. Elegance, character and originality are the main characteristics that can be found in the labels of this company, which is located in the heart of the region and which has the ambition to establish itself at the highest level. Waris-Larmandier boasts Grand Cru vineyards in the Côte des Blancs, in Chouilly, Cramant, Avize, Oger and Le Mesnil-sur-Oger, the top for Chardonnay.
